
Courtney Rogers, 35, has 10 children under the age of 10, though having a big family was neither completely on or off the table in her early 20s. But fast forward 10 years and Courtney and her husband are proud parents to a set of fraternal twins and three sets of Irish twins, and the New Mexico-based couple couldn't be happier.
"I honestly can't remember if I wanted a large family," Courtney told POPSUGAR. "I just knew I wanted kids and that I'm truly satisfied being a stay-at-home mom. My husband and I are both from large families. I'm the oldest of six and he's the oldest of 10. We also grew up with tons of cousins so large families and being around kids is normal for us."
Courtney has enjoyed being pregnant, though she did experience a few hardships. She had two miscarriages, and the twins presented her with some challenges.
"My body handles pregnancies well. I didn't have morning sickness, high blood pressure, or hyperemesis gravidarum (HG), nor have I ever been put on bed rest," she explained. "However, two of my pregnancies did include 'random' issues. One ended up being an emergency C-section due to unresolved complete placenta previa and my twins were delivered just over six weeks early because of a cord issue."
